Filevine is a Legal AI company delivering Legal Operating Intelligence for the future of legal work. They are seeking a talented and experienced Senior Javascript Full Stack Engineer to create high-quality, user-friendly web applications and collaborate with cross-functional teams to define and ship new features.
Responsibilities:
- Design, develop, and maintain high-quality web applications using JavaScript, Node.js, and React
- Collaborate with cross-functional teams to define, design, and ship new features
- Analyze and resolve technical and application problems
- Adhere to high-quality development principles while delivering solutions on-time and on-budget
- Debug production issues across services and multiple levels of the stack with an eye towards improving maintainability over the long term
- Improve engineering standards, tooling, and processes
Requirements:
- 7+ years React experience (class & functional components)
- Strong JavaScript/TypeScript skills
- Node.js & Express.js backend experience
- Experience with cloud platforms (GCP preferred)
- Experience with complex rich text editors (DraftJS, TipTap, or similar)
- Webpack & modern build tooling
- B.S. in computer science, information systems, a related field; comparable certifications; or equivalent direct work experience
- AI/ML API integration experience
- Elasticsearch experience
- Legacy codebase experience
- Performance optimization
- Firebase experience
- PDF/DOCX document processing
- Docker & CI/CD experience
- Legal tech domain experience
- MobX state management